Company Overview
Gujarat Fluorochemicals Limited reported its consolidated financial results for FY 2025-26, showing revenue growth of 5% YoY to ₹4,996.03 Crores with PAT increasing 5% to ₹573.76 Crores. The company declared a final dividend of ₹3.00 per equity share and scheduled its Eighth Annual General Meeting for 24th September 2026.
Financial Performance
Consolidated FY 2025-26: Revenue from Operations reached ₹4,996.03 Crores (5% increase from ₹4,737.49 Crores in FY 2024-25), EBITDA stood at ₹1,291 Crores (12% increase YoY), and Profit After Tax was ₹573.76 Crores. Export revenue grew to ₹3,017 Crores from ₹2,818 Crores.
Standalone Performance: Revenue from operations was ₹4,541.59 Crores with net profit of ₹677.71 Crores (17% increase from ₹575.36 Crores) and basic EPS of ₹61.69. The company maintained strong financial ratios with Current Ratio of 1.75 and Debt-Equity Ratio of 0.22.
Business Segment Performance
Fluoropolymers Business delivered strong performance with revenue of ₹3,154 Crores (14% YoY growth), driven by demand from semiconductors, EVs, battery energy storage systems, and data centers. The company is investing ₹250 Crores in new fluoropolymer capacity.
Fluorochemicals Business revenue declined 2% YoY despite challenging global environment. The company commissioned R-32 production in March 2026 (10,000-tonne capacity) and plans to double capacity to 20,000 tonnes.
Battery Materials Business (GFCL EV) showed significant progress with cumulative investment of ₹1,900-₹2,000 Crores to date. LiPF6 salt qualified by major global electrolyte manufacturers, and LFP cathode active material facility commissioned with customer samples approved. The company is planning natural graphite anode active material facility and targeting ₹6,000 Crores cumulative investment by FY 2027-28.
Capital Expenditure and Financing
FY 2026-27 Capex: ₹3,150 Crores allocated with ₹2,300 Crores for EV business expansion and ₹850 Crores for chemicals business. The company announced a Greenfield battery materials project in Oman with US$216 Million investment.
Financing Activities: GFCL EV Products issued 4,29,99,999 Series A CCPS to International Finance Corporation for ₹430 Cr. The company implemented an ESOP scheme with 1,40,30,000 options granted in FY26 with various exercise prices and vesting periods.
Corporate Governance and Compliance
The company disclosed remuneration of ₹18.77 crore to Managing Director Vivek Jain including ₹12.06 crore commission payable post-AGM approval. Paid ₹0.20 crore in sitting fees to Non-Executive Directors with no material related party transactions reported.
Received stock exchange fines totaling ₹10.62 lakh for board composition non-compliance under Regulation 17(1) of Listing Regulations. All fines paid and defaults made good. CRISIL Limited reaffirmed rating on long-term bank facilities and NCDs as CRISIL AA+/Stable.
Shareholding and Ownership
Promoter holding remained stable at 57.69% with Inox Leasing holding 52.61% and Aryavardhan Trading LLP holding 5.08%. Total shareholders stood at 64,227 with 92.32% shares held by 280 shareholders (10,001+ shares).
